Overview
The AD7810YRZ-REEL7 is a 10-bit successive approximation analog-to-digital converter (ADC) manufactured by Analog Devices Inc. It operates on a single supply voltage ranging from 2.7 V to 5.5 V and features an inherent track-and-hold function with a conversion time of 2.3 µs maximum. The device utilizes a pseudo-differential input architecture and communicates via a high-speed serial interface compatible with standard SPI protocols. Packaged in an 8-lead microSOIC format, it supports throughput rates up to 350 kSPS while maintaining low power consumption, which can be further minimized through automatic power-down modes at lower sampling frequencies.
Feature Summary
- Inherent track-and-hold functionality eliminates the need for external holding capacitors.
- Automatic power-down mode significantly reduces average power consumption at lower throughput rates.
- Microcontroller-compatible serial interface allows direct connection without additional glue logic.
- Pseudo-differential input structure enables offset cancellation capabilities.

Part Context
This part belongs to the AD7810 family of low-power, high-speed ADCs. It shares architectural similarities with other members like the AD7811 and AD7812 but differs in channel count and interface types. The Y variant specifically denotes the industrial temperature grade and linearity performance within the broader product lineup.
